Smith & Myers perform Wednesday in Stroudsburg

Smith & Myers, featuring Brent Smith, frontman for Shinedown, and Zach Myers, the band’s guitarist, will be performing in concert at the Sherman Theater at 8 p.m. Wednesday.

The theater is located at 524 Main St. in Stroudsburg.

Smith & Myers is an acoustic side project by the pair, that was born when the Florida band’s marketing representative at Atlantic Records suggested the band hold a contest online where fans would submit songs they’d like to hear the band cover acoustically.

They received a huge response, eventually whittling down the submissions to an initial six, with four more to be revealed at a later date.

Accompanied by YouTube videos of the two musicians performing each song, the (Acoustic Sessions) EP was released in early 2014 under the name Smith & Myers.

Some of the songs included in the project are the Clash’s “London Calling,” Metallica’s “Nothing Else Matters” and Soul Asylum’s “Runaway Train.”

Special guests for this performance will be JR Moore and Zack Mack.
